《電子技術(shù)應(yīng)用》
您所在的位置:首頁 > 其他 > 设计应用 > 旋转变压器软解码算法分析研究
旋转变压器软解码算法分析研究
2023年电子技术应用第5期
宋建国,刘小周,李子豪
(北京工业大学 信息学部,北京 100124)
摘要: 永磁同步电机矢量控制当中,需要获得电机转子准确的电角度,在工业控制当中电机位置传感器常采用旋转变压器获取电机转子位置。旋转变压器位置解码常采用专用解码芯片获取电机转子位置,但解码芯片增加硬件开发成本,故对旋转变压器的位置解码进行软件算法设计分析。针对传统二阶角度跟踪器对加速度跟踪效果不佳的问题进行优化设计,提出对二阶跟踪器进行前馈校正装置设计以达到更好的角度跟踪效果。通过MATLAB/Simulink对软件算法进行仿真验证。采用MCAL配置TC275外设DSADC解码旋变信息,通过实验进进行结果验证方案的可行性。
中圖分類號(hào):TM383.2
文獻(xiàn)標(biāo)志碼:A
DOI: 10.16157/j.issn.0258-7998.223410
中文引用格式: 宋建國,劉小周,李子豪. 旋轉(zhuǎn)變壓器軟解碼算法分析研究[J]. 電子技術(shù)應(yīng)用,2023,49(5):62-66.
英文引用格式: Song Jianguo,Liu Xiaozhou,Li Zihao. Research and analysis on soft decoding algorithm of resolver[J]. Application of Electronic Technique,2023,49(5):62-66.
Research and analysis on soft decoding algorithm of resolver
Song Jianguo,Liu Xiaozhou,Li Zihao
(Faculty of Information Technology, Beijing University of Technology, Beijing 100124,China)
Abstract: In the vector control of the permanent magnet synchronous motor, it is necessary to obtain the accurate electrical angle of the motor rotor. In industrial control, the motor position sensor often uses a resolver to obtain the motor rotor position. Decoding the resolver position usually uses a dedicated decoding chip to obtain the rotor position of the motor, but the decoding chip increases the hardware development cost. In this paper, the software algorithm design and analysis for the position decoding of the resolver is carried out. The traditional second-order angle tracker has a poor acceleration tracking effect and is optimized, and a feedforward correction device design for the second-order tracker is proposed to achieve better angle tracking effect. The software algorithm is simulated and verified by MATLAB/Simulink. The MCAL is used to configure the TC275 peripheral DSADC to decode the resolver information, and the feasibility of the scheme is verified through experiments.
Key words : resolver;soft decoding;angle tracking word;feedforward correction

0 引言

永磁同步電機(jī)因其獨(dú)特的結(jié)構(gòu)特點(diǎn)以及高性能轉(zhuǎn)速,永磁同步電機(jī)控制采用矢量控制 。這種控制方式要求獲取電機(jī)轉(zhuǎn)子的準(zhǔn)確位置。目前常采用光電編碼器、磁編碼器和旋轉(zhuǎn)變壓器(Resolver,旋變)。

光電編碼器與磁編碼器工作環(huán)境不能夠適應(yīng)震動(dòng)高溫等惡劣環(huán)境,可靠性差。所以,旋變被廣泛地應(yīng)用在汽車、工業(yè)伺服系統(tǒng)、航天等。

旋變輸入的是一組正余弦信號(hào),在電機(jī)旋轉(zhuǎn)的過程因轉(zhuǎn)子所處的位置不同得到兩組幅值隨轉(zhuǎn)子位置變化的正余弦信號(hào)量。通常采用專用的旋變解碼芯片解析出轉(zhuǎn)子位置,常采用的旋變解碼芯片AD2S1205等。解碼芯片可以產(chǎn)生高頻信號(hào)到旋變,然后讀取旋變輸出信號(hào),芯片內(nèi)部運(yùn)算得到轉(zhuǎn)子的位置和速度,解碼芯片將位置、速度及相關(guān)信息上傳至單片機(jī)。但是在系統(tǒng)當(dāng)中加一個(gè)專用解碼芯片,加大了電路冗余,增加了開發(fā)成本。本文采用英飛凌TC275車規(guī)級(jí)芯片。底層采用AUTOSAR底層MCAL配置。TC275單片機(jī)內(nèi)部集成外設(shè)DSADC。DSADC內(nèi)部對(duì)旋變輸出信號(hào)進(jìn)行處理,最后得到正余弦信號(hào),對(duì)正余弦解碼獲取位置信息有多種方式,對(duì)正余弦進(jìn)行反正切查表獲取位置信息。但這種獲取轉(zhuǎn)子位置有一定的缺點(diǎn),文中對(duì)目前使用最廣的二階角度跟蹤器進(jìn)行誤差分析,并提出一種以二階角度跟蹤器為基礎(chǔ)的帶前饋校正結(jié)構(gòu)的角度跟蹤器。



本文詳細(xì)內(nèi)容請(qǐng)下載:http://m.ihrv.cn/resource/share/2000005321




作者信息:

宋建國,劉小周,李子豪

(北京工業(yè)大學(xué) 信息學(xué)部,北京 100124)


微信圖片_20210517164139.jpg

此內(nèi)容為AET網(wǎng)站原創(chuàng),未經(jīng)授權(quán)禁止轉(zhuǎn)載。